| GoldMoney's Patents |
|
GoldMoney has received four US patents for inventing digital gold currency. An application for a fifth patent is pending. The awarding of these patents acknowledges that GoldMoney is advancing the 'prior art' of global online payments. Namely, we have created a more advanced, and therefore better currency than the currency that now exists. The patents illustrate why GoldMoney is a currency that is ideally suited for ecommerce. The first patent application was filed in February 1993, and US Patent No. 5,671,364 (PDF file) was awarded in September 1997. This patent provides for a system and method that enables gold or other commodities (tangible assets) to circulate through an electronic medium as currency in a book entry accounting system. The second patent, US Patent No. 5,983,207 (PDF file), was awarded in November 1999. This patent provides for a system and method that enables gold or other commodities to circulate electronically as digital cash, ensuring privacy and facilitating micro-payments. The third patent, US Patent No. 6,415,271 (PDF file), was awarded in July 2002. This patent provides for a system and method that enables gold or other commodities to circulate electronically as digital cash over wireless networks and by means of electronic devices such as smart cards. The fourth patent, US Patent No. 7,143,062 (PDF file), was awarded in November 2006. This patent provides for a system and method that enables gold to circulate as digital cash through a global computer network such as the Internet and/or private communication networks, much like cash currently circulates in the physical world. All four patents may also be viewed at the U.S. Patent Office's website (www.uspto.gov). |
